What is a Personal Injury Claim?

In the simplest terms, a personal injury claim is a legal dispute that arises when you are injured because someone else was careless, reckless, or intentionally harmful. The legal principle at the heart of most of these cases is negligence.

To have a valid personal injury claim, our attorneys will typically need to prove four key elements:

  1. Duty of Care: The other party (the defendant) owed you a legal duty to act with reasonable care. For example, every driver on Arizona State Route 79 has a duty to obey traffic laws and drive safely to protect others on the road.
  2. Breach of Duty: The defendant failed to meet that duty. A driver who was texting, speeding, or driving under the influence has breached their duty of care.
  3. Causation: This breach of duty directly caused your injuries. In other words, you would not have been hurt if not for the defendant's negligent actions.
  4. Damages: You suffered actual harm as a result of the injury. This includes measurable financial losses like medical bills and lost income, as well as non-financial harm like pain and suffering.

Compensation Available in a Florence, Arizona Personal Injury Lawsuit

After an accident, the financial strain can be just as debilitating as the physical pain. The goal of a personal injury lawsuit is to make you "whole" again by providing financial compensation, known as damages, for all that you have lost. While no amount of money can undo your suffering, a fair settlement or verdict can provide the financial stability you need to heal and move forward with your life.

In a Florence personal injury case, our attorneys will fight for several types of damages on your behalf:

  • Economic Damages: These are the tangible, verifiable financial losses you have incurred. They have a clear dollar value and can be proven with bills, receipts, and financial statements. This includes compensation for all past and future medical expenses (hospital stays, surgery, physical therapy, medication), lost wages from time off work, and loss of future earning capacity if your injuries prevent you from returning to your job.
  • Non-Economic Damages: These damages compensate you for the intangible, subjective losses that don’t have a price tag. Though harder to calculate, they are just as real and devastating. This includes pain and suffering, emotional distress, scarring and disfigurement, loss of enjoyment of life, and loss of consortium (the impact on your relationship with your spouse).

In rare cases involving extreme recklessness or intentional misconduct, punitive damages may be awarded. These are not meant to compensate the victim but rather to punish the wrongdoer and deter similar behavior in the future.

How long do I have to file a personal injury lawsuit in Arizona?
In Arizona, the statute of limitations for most personal injury claims is two years from the date the injury occurred. If you fail to file a lawsuit within this two-year window, you will likely lose your right to seek compensation forever. There are some exceptions, but it is critical to contact an attorney as soon as possible to protect your rights.

What if I am partially at fault for the accident?
Arizona follows a “pure comparative negligence” rule. This means you can still recover damages even if you were partially at fault for the accident. However, your total compensation will be reduced by your percentage of fault. For example, if you were found to be 20% at fault, your final award would be reduced by 20%. How long will my personal injury case take to resolve?
The timeline for a personal injury case varies greatly depending on its complexity, the severity of your injuries, and the willingness of the insurance company to negotiate a fair settlement. A straightforward case might settle in a few months, while a complex case that goes to trial could take a year or more.
